Cory is a shooter, match director and all-around enabler to the addiction we call competitive shooting. He uses shooting to push himself to improve himself and compete daily. He is involved with four local clubs wearing hats as a match director, social media coordinator and RO/Stage Designer.
In 2014 Cory started shooting USPSA when he had to borrow a pistol from a friend to shoot his first match. Over the years, he has always remembered that the help of a friend got him into the shooting sports. At every match, Cory brings extra guns and ammo just in case someone needs that first taste of shooting with the help of a friend. He is now a Grand Master in three USPSA divisions including PCC where he can pursue his true passion: rifles.
In 2017, Cory borrowed an optic and shot his first PRS match and is now seemingly obsessed with the precision rifle game. He can regularly be found at the range with his LRP-07 match rifle, JP-15 trainer and training partners from the TX Precision club. As precision rifle competitions expand Cory has set lofty personal and recruitment goals.
